Start for free

How to Embed Webinars on Websites: A Complete Guide

by Maxim Poulsen, updated on Apr 16, 2024

Hosting a webinar is a great way to engage with your audience. But what happens after the live session ends? Embedding webinar recordings on your website makes it easy for audiences to discover them. This webinar embedding guide will show you how to make your webinars a lasting part of your site's content.

What Does it Mean to Embed a Webinar on Your Website

Embedding sounds techy, but it's pretty simple. It allows visitors to watch the webinar without having to leave your site or navigate to another platform. It’s just adding a video player to your page that plays your webinar.

Here’s what it looks like when you embed a Contrast webinar on your website. 

Screenshot showing what an embedded webinar on a website looks like
An example of an embedded Contrast webinar

Why You Should Embed Webinars on Websites

Embedding webinar recordings on your website isn't just a fancy feature; it's a strategic move. Here’s why:

  • Boost Engagement: Videos are engaging. When you embed a webinar, you’re offering content that's more likely to capture and hold attention.
  • Increased Time on Site: People spend more time on pages with engaging videos, which helps your search engine optimization (SEO).
  • SEO Benefits: Diverse content types, including videos, are favored by search engines. Embedding videos on pages can improve your chances of ranking higher in Google search results. 
  • Wider Reach: People who just discovered your website won’t know that you hosted a website last week or last month. You need to tell them. Embedding webinar recordings on websites makes them discoverable to a wider audience.
  • Authority Building: By sharing your knowledge through embedded webinars, you position yourself as an authority in your field. This helps build trust with your audience.
  • Lead Generation: Embedding webinars can be an effective way to generate leads, especially if you include a sign-up form or call-to-action (CTA) before or after the webinar.
  • Social Proof: People subconsciously look for validation from others when evaluating your company. Webinars co-hosted with other companies or influencers that are embedded on your website act as a form of social proof. The brain says, “Oh, they trust this brand, so I can too.”

How to Embed Webinars on Websites

We’re about to dive deep into how you can embed webinars on websites. We’ll explore choosing the right platform, embedding the webinar recording itself, and ensuring everything runs smoothly across all devices.

Choosing the Right Webinar Platform

Before you can embed a webinar, you need to choose a webinar platform. You want one that's not just easy to use but also packs a punch when it comes to features. Here's what to look for:

  • Ease of Use: It should be simple for both you and your audience. No one likes to wrestle with complicated software. Hosting webinars and later embedding them on your website should be easy. 
  • Integration Capabilities: The platform should play nice with other tools. For example, Contrast’s HubSpot integration can be set up in less than 2 minutes and automatically adds webinar attendees as contacts in your CRM.
  • Quality and Reliability: Look for crisp video and audio quality and reliability. You don’t want a platform that will let you down mid-webinar.
  • Engagement Features: Interactive elements like polls, Q&A sessions, and chat features can make your webinar more engaging.
  • Analytics: Understanding your audience's behavior is key. A good platform offers insights into viewership and webinar engagement metrics.

We’ve built a free webinar platform that ticks all these boxes. It's designed for modern, engaging webinars. It’s built for growing teams that want to scale fast. That’s why we offer unlimited seats on every plan. Even our free one. 

Contrast’s Clip Ai feature automatically creates clips from webinars
Our Clip Ai feature automatically creates clips from webinars

Contrast also has loads of AI features. Repurpose Ai transforms your webinars into other types of content like blogs, social posts, and emails. Clip Ai grabs the best moments automatically. With Contrast, you're all set for the fun parts of hosting webinars without sweating the small stuff.

Take your Webinars to the Next Level

Start for free with up to 50 registrants. No credit card needed.

Start for free

How to Embed Webinar On Websites

The exact instructions might vary depending on your webinar platform and website CMS. But at a high level the steps are the same. To embed a webinar on your website, you'll start by copying the embed code directly from your webinar platform. Next, you’ll paste that embed code into an iframe or html code block on your page. 

If your webinar software doesn’t automatically generate embed codes for video recordings, you’ll have to download the video first. You’ll then upload the video to a hosting and video analytics tool like Contrast or YouTube. From there, use the provided embed code to place your webinar on any page. 

Contrast users can embed webinars on websites easily. Here’s how: 

  1. Go to your admin dashboard
  2. Click on Videos
  3. Click the three-dot more options icon on the video you want to embed on your website
  4. Click Share
  5. Click Embed and then the Copy embed code button
Screenshot showing how to find a webinar embed code in Contrast’s platform
Contrast makes it easy to embed webinars on websites

Embed Zoom Webinar on Website

If you’re here because you’re struggling to embed a Zoom webinar on a website, you’re not alone. For a company their size, they’ve made it surprisingly difficult to embed Zoom recordings on websites. 

The first option is complicated. You’ll need to get your developers or IT team to spend a bunch of time integrating their developer SDK into your site. Their other official recommendation for embedding Zoom webinars is to download the recording and upload it to YouTube.  

Screenshot from Zoom’s support forum showing how to embed zoom webinars on websites
Zoom’s official recommendation for embedding webinar recordings

We’re not fans of this approach for a few reasons. The first one is that it creates an unnecessary extra step in your workflow.

But if you are using Zoom for webinars and can’t switch to Contrast or another Zoom webinar alternative right now, you can still upload your recording to our platform instead of YouTube. 

When you embed YouTube videos, you're stuck with their branding. It might not mesh well with your site's look. It can also make things feel less polished. Plus, there's a YouTube logo that takes viewers away to YouTube where you might lose their attention. After your video ends, YouTube might suggest totally unrelated videos, pulling folks away from your content. And let's not forget ads. YouTube can play ads before or during your video, which is never fun. 

For more info about Zoom, check out this guide: Contrast vs. Zoom Webinar - The Ultimate Comparison

Testing and Troubleshooting Embedded Webinars

Always test your embedded webinar before publishing your page. Webinars embedded via Contrast will look great by default. But, we can’t speak for other platforms. So double-check that your embedded webinar is responsive on different screen sizes. Tools like EmbedResponsively are really helpful for making sure YouTube or Vimeo embeds look right.

Get Analytics for Embedded Videos

This is the second way you can embed videos for free with Contrast. It’s also the better option because it gives you access to video analytics. 

All you need to do is create a free account and upload your videos there. We’ll generate an embed code for the video and also give you access to all of our video analytics. This way, you can keep an eye on metrics like views, watch time, and most watched moments. 

Screenshot showing Contrast’s video analytics
Contrast offers free video analytics for any type of video you upload and embed

Upload and Embed any Type of Video for Free

Free video hosting with a customizable player and rich analytics

Create a free account

Where to Embed Webinars On Websites

There are a lot of different places you can embed webinars on websites. You want to choose spots where that are easy to find and relevant to your visitors. Here's a look at some prime locations for your webinar content.

Embed Webinars on Dedicated Landing Pages

One thing you can do is make specific pages for your webinars. Here’s an example we liked from Chameleon. They embedded their webinar on a dedicated landing page and even included short 1-2 minute highlight clips from the webinar lower down on the page for those that don’t want to watch the entire recording. 

Screenshot an embedded webinar on a dedicated landing page from
Example of an embedded webinar on a landing page

Embed Webinars in Blogs

Another great idea is to embed webinars into blog posts. If you have a relevant webinar recording for the topic being discussed in an article, you should embed it. It enriches your content and keeps readers hooked.

Embed Webinars on Product Pages

You don’t have to limit embedded webinars on your website to just content pages. You can also use webinars to showcase the products or services you sell. Those webinars can be embedded on product pages. They can help give a deeper understanding of your offering. 

Embed Webinars in Resource Libraries

If you have a resource library on your website you can embed webinars there. With a Contrast account, you get a dedicated webinar channel built automatically for you. This channel serves as a home for all your webinars. This makes it easy for your viewers to find and watch your entire webinar collection in one place.

Screenshot of Contrast’s webinar channel feature
Contrast automatically builds a webinar channel for your recordings

Embed Webinars in Knowledge Bases 

Adding webinars to your knowledge base and customer support articles can add value to your users. It's a smart way to show, not just tell, solutions or features. This approach can make complex topics easier to understand. It also adds an interactive element to your support articles.

Best Practices for Webinar Embedding

Embedding webinars on websites is more than just sharing content. It's about enhancing user experience. Here's what to keep in mind to do it right.

Optimize for On-Demand Views

At Contrast, we’re firm believers in the magic of live webinars. But since 63% of webinar views are on-demand, you need to make your content replay-friendly. Think long-term. Your webinar should still make sense years from now, even for folks who weren't there live.

Contrast statistics showing that 65% of webinar views are on-demand
Contrast data shows that most webinar views are on-demand

Avoid references to specific dates or events that might not make sense later. We always recommend adding polls and Q&As into webinars to make them more engaging, but keep on-demand viewers in mind when doing so. But don’t let those create overly long pauses or gaps in the content. Waiting for answers or questions to roll in might feel normal when you’re recording live. But it creates a lull in a replay view. You don’t want on-demand viewers losing attention in those moments. 

SEO Tips for Embedding Webinars on Websites

As we covered, embedding webinars on websites can help with video SEO. But you need to use the right video markup language in your code to help Google detect, understand, and rank your content better. Contrast does this automatically for you, but we can’t speak for other platforms. 

Here’s what you need to know if your webinar platform doesn’t handle the SEO:

Google uses the standardized VideoObject markup to know what videos are about. You’ll add a simple code with your video's name, thumbnail URL, video URL, and upload date to your site. This information helps Google showcase your video in search results. Including a description, duration, and key moments also helps, but is not required. 

You should also include text on the page about what's in your webinar. This helps search engines like Google know what your webinar covers.

FAQ about Webinar Embeds on Websites

Can I embed live webinars?

When using Contrast, your live webinars are already embedded on the same link as your registration page. We do this so that anyone invited to the webinar can find the live webinar easily. 

Will embedding a webinar slow down my website?

Embedding a webinar shouldn't significantly slow down your site. We’ve tested our embedding tools extensively and know that they don’t impact page speed in any material way. Like anything though, your mileage may vary on other platforms. You can test out your page speed using Google’s PageSpeed Insights tool. 

How can I measure the success of my embedded webinars?

Your webinar platform’s built-in analytics should track views from embedded webinars, but you might have to double-check that embedded views are counted. Contrast provides detailed analytics and even shows you views specifically from embedded webinars. 

Can I customize the appearance of the embedded webinar player?

When it comes to free tools, most video players are not very customizable. With Contrast’s free branded video player you can change the color, upload your own thumbnail, add video chapters, and customize the video’s title and description. 

Wrapping up our Webinar Embedding Guide

Webinar embeds on websites are a powerful way to distribute your webinars to a wider audience. You're not just sharing content; you're enhancing the value of that page for your site visitors. Ready to start embedding webinars on your site? Create a free Contrast account today to upload your webinar recordings or host new webinars. 

Upload and Embed Webinar Recordings for Free

Free webinar hosting with a customizable player and rich analytics

Create a free account